Software Composition Analysis Market Insights

Software Composition Analysis Market size was valued at USD 585.66 Million in 2024 and is poised to grow from USD 709.82 Million in 2025 to USD 3305 Million by 2033, growing at a CAGR of 21.2% during the forecast period (2026–2033).

The software composition analysis market is rapidly expanding because of its increasing dependency on open-source software in modern applications and the rising need to manage security vulnerabilities and license compliance. Moreover, software composition analysis (SCA) tools help companies in identifying, tracking, and managing open-source components in their software. This makes sure that the components are free from vulnerabilities and comply with licensing requirements. The main factors that are boosting the growth of the market are the rise in cyber threats targeting software supply chains, strict regulatory requirements like GDPR and HIPAA. The move towards DevSecOps practices that can incorporate security early in the development procedure is also fueling growth of the market.  

The increasing utilization of open-source software is a significant driver for the software composition analysis market growth. This is because organizations in different industries are making use of open-source components to improve development processes, minimize expenses, and benefit from the collective innovation of global developer communities. Open-source software offers the flexibility and scalability necessary for modern applications, enabling organizations to develop robust solutions without starting from scratch. Furthermore, compliance with open-source licenses is vital for avoiding legal repercussions. This increased dependency on open-source software requires efficient management solutions for making sure that all components are secure, updated, and comply with relevant licenses.

Analysis by Deployment Model 

Based on deployment model, the cloud-based segment is dominating the market with the largest software composition analysis market share. Cloud-based SCA solutions provide scalable resources that can easily adapt with the changing requirements of organizations, accommodating everything from small projects to large enterprise applications. Cloud deployment helps organizations to quickly implement and scale SCA tools as their software development requirements. This provides immense flexibility in managing open-source components across different projects and teams. Similarly, cloud-based SCA tools can smoothly incorporate with DevOps practices and continuous integration/continuous deployment (CI/CD) pipelines. This allows automated and continuous monitoring of open-source components throughout the development lifecycle. 

The on-premises segment is expected to grow at a significant CAGR during the forecast period. Companies that prioritize control over their IT assets, including software tools like SCA solutions, do this to align with their organizational culture and government regulations. These companies often have strict policies about data security, compliance, and risk management, which require direct management of technology assets. By selecting the on-premises implementation of SCA solutions, these organizations will get full control over their data, infrastructure, and security protocols. Moreover, this method also enables them to implement customized security measures, integrate smoothly with their current IT environments. On-premises solutions also help companies to strictly follow the regulatory requirements without depending on external service providers. 

Analysis by Vertical 

Based on vertical, the BFSI segment is dominating the software composition analysis market. Financial facilities are more likely to be targeted by cyberattacks because of the immense value of financial data and the possible financial gains for hackers. These institutions manage sensitive information like customer financial records, transaction details, and personal identification data, making them the main targets for cybercriminals stealing money, committing fraud, or disrupting financial markets. In such a high-stakes environment, SCA tools are playing a vital part in enhancing the position of cybersecurity. By constantly scanning and analyzing open-source components utilized in their software applications, SCA tools can efficiently recognize vulnerabilities that can be exploited by cybercriminals. These vulnerabilities can exist in libraries, frameworks, or dependencies integrated into financial systems. Therefore, it is necessary that quick identification and mitigation of these vulnerabilities are conducted for minimizing the impact of attack and strengthen defenses against potential exploits. 

As per software composition analysis market forecast, the retail & e-commerce segment will continue to experience the fastest growth in recent years. Retail and e-commerce organizers are utilizing digital technologies to drive sales, improve inventory management, and enhance the overall customer experience. With this transformation, the dependency on incorporating open-source components into their software solutions is also increasing. These components offer cost-efficient and innovative functionalities but also introduce security and compliance challenges. This incorporation of open-source software is increasing the requirement for strong SCA tools so that it can efficiently manage and reduce risks related to vulnerabilities and license compliance issues in the retail sector. Software composition analysis tools play a crucial role in the retail & e-commerce sector for constantly monitoring and analyzing open-source components used in digital platforms. It helps the companies to maintain strict security standards and regulatory requirements.

Software Composition Analysis Market Regional Insights

North America is dominating with the largest software composition analysis market share.  The regions of North America like the United States and Canada, maintains rigorous regulatory frameworks across industries like healthcare, finance, and government. They follow the rules formulated by HIPAA, PCI-DSS, and FISMA. Their regulations mandate strict data protection and software compliance standards. SCA solutions are important for enterprises in these sectors as they make sure they follow the regulatory requirements. It is done by identifying and reducing vulnerabilities in open-source software components. By managing licensing issues and improving software security practices, SCA tools assist companies to maintain compliance, reduce risks of data breaches, and maintain trust among stakeholders. It supports the company's efforts in safeguarding sensitive information and meeting regulatory mandates efficiently. 

Over the course of the projected period, it is anticipated that the software composition analysis market in Asia Pacific would expand with the highest growth. Asia Pacific is going through rapid digital transformation across various sectors, resulting in widespread adoption of open-source software to drive innovation and efficiency. This surge in open-source usage necessitates robust management of security and compliance to prevent vulnerabilities and legal issues. SCA tools are critical for this because they offer comprehensive information about the open-source components, recognizing potential risks and ensuring adherence to regulatory standards. The increasing dependency on digital technologies and open-source software in the region fuels the demand for SCA solutions, making them extremely valuable for maintaining secure and follow software development practices.

Recent Developments

  • In April 2024, Synopsys announced the launch of Black Duck Supply Chain Edition with the aim of improving the security aspect of the software supply chain. This offering incorporates several open-source detection tools, automated Software Bill Of Material’s (SBOM) scanning systems, and malicious code neutralization. It communicates with the development and security groups about the risks estimation and risk management pertaining to Open Source, third-party code, and AI, attacks targeting the software’s vulnerabilities, legal conflicts concerning codes, and hostile codes inclusivity.  
  • In March 2024, GitGuardian announced the development of a new SCA module specialized for DevSecOps processes. These modules assist security teams as well as developer teams by providing a single solution for vulnerability handling. It enables rapid detection of vulnerable dependencies, categorization of issues based on criticality level, and assistance on how to handle the issues. The SCA module in addition evaluates and alerts on potential legal issues in relation to the software supply chain with respect to licensing and security policies.  
  • In June 2024, FossID, one of the prominent providers of open-source software risk management technologies and services, has announced the release of FossID Workbench 24.2. The release equips the software with ID Assist, which is a new module that uses artificial intelligence to ease the Software Composition Analysis (SCA) tooling work load thereby saving time and expertise invented.

As per SkyQuest analysis, software composition analysis (SCA) is a vital security practice that emphasizes on recognizing and managing open-source components utilized in applications, ensuring licensing compliance, and improving code quality. With the growing software composition analysis market trend of adopting IoT andcloud-based services, the usage of open-source software in software development has increased. The software composition analysis tools help in identifying vulnerabilities in manifest files, source code, binary files, container images, and bill of materials (BoM). Furthermore, the importance of software composition analysis is also increasing in securing software to prevent cyberattack that can jeopardize the security of an organization or a country, resulting in the growth of the market.
